One of the first steps to lasting longer in SCUM 1.0 is to expand your storage, and building the Improvised Courier Backpack makes that simple.

The game leaves out some details, so new players could overlook key mechanics like Vicinity that are important for crafting.

This means that if you wander off or don’t drag them into your hands or clothing slots (like pockets or holsters), you risk leaving behind essential materials without realizing it.

That’s why managing your inventory correctly is the first step toward building this backpack.

How To Craft In SCUM?

You’ll begin with almost nothing when you spawn, so start by looking for two rocks on the ground.

Combine them using the crafting menu to make a stone knife. This knife is your tool for everything: cutting bushes, tearing clothes, and more.

Once you have it, drop your shirt and pants on the ground and right-click to tear them into rags.

These rags will fall into the vicinity unless you have empty space in your pockets, so be sure to move them into your inventory immediately, or you may lose them when walking away.

You need at least three rags to craft the backpack later. Next, you’ll need to gather a lot of sticks.

How To Get More Crafting Materials In SCUM?

Use your stone knife to cut down bushes, which will drop long sticks.

When bushes are scattered, bundle sticks together to carry more at once and bring them to a central spot. After that, you’ll need to make rope, and you’ve got two main ways to do it.

Start by making straps from rags, then join five of them to form an improvised rope. The other is by using sticks directly to craft the rope, depending on which materials you’ve got more of.

Either way, make sure the rope ends up in the same vicinity area or in your inventory with the rags and knife.

How To Craft an Improvised Courier Backpack In Scum?

Once everything—knife, rags, and rope—is either on the ground in one spot or in your backpack or inventory, open the crafting menu.

Type “Improvised Courier Backpack” into the search bar, and the option should appear. If it doesn’t, double-check that all the materials are present and not scattered.

When the craft button lights up, click it, and your character will begin crafting the backpack. It increases how much you can carry, which is super useful for picking up food, tools, or materials.

If gear goes missing early on, resetting your character is usually quicker than hunting for rags or crafting a new knife.

For a side gig, make extra backpacks, pack them with loot, and then sell them at the General Store to earn some good starting money.
